Home
last modified time | relevance | path

Searched defs:prsc (Results 1 – 25 of 61) sorted by relevance

123

/external/mesa3d/src/gallium/drivers/v3d/
Dv3d_resource.c48 struct pipe_resource *prsc = &rsc->base; in v3d_debug_resource_layout() local
99 struct pipe_resource *prsc = &rsc->base; in v3d_resource_bo_alloc() local
174 struct pipe_resource *prsc, in v3d_map_usage_prep()
224 struct pipe_resource *prsc, in v3d_resource_transfer_map()
343 struct pipe_resource *prsc, in v3d_texture_subdata()
388 struct pipe_resource *prsc) in v3d_resource_destroy()
403 struct pipe_resource *prsc, in v3d_resource_get_handle()
501 struct pipe_resource *prsc = &rsc->base; in v3d_setup_slices() local
664 v3d_layer_offset(struct pipe_resource *prsc, uint32_t level, uint32_t layer) in v3d_layer_offset()
683 struct pipe_resource *prsc = &rsc->base; in v3d_resource_setup() local
[all …]
Dv3d_job.c52 const struct pipe_resource *prsc = entry->key; in v3d_job_free() local
135 v3d_job_add_write_resource(struct v3d_job *job, struct pipe_resource *prsc) in v3d_job_add_write_resource()
161 v3d_job_add_tf_write_resource(struct v3d_job *job, struct pipe_resource *prsc) in v3d_job_add_tf_write_resource()
173 struct pipe_resource *prsc) in v3d_job_writes_resource_from_tf()
186 struct pipe_resource *prsc, in v3d_flush_jobs_writing_resource()
235 struct pipe_resource *prsc, in v3d_flush_jobs_reading_resource()
Dv3dx_state.c833 struct pipe_resource *prsc, in v3d_setup_texture_shader_state()
901 struct pipe_resource *prsc = so->texture; in v3dX() local
985 v3d_create_sampler_view(struct pipe_context *pctx, struct pipe_resource *prsc, in v3d_create_sampler_view()
1182 struct pipe_resource *prsc, in v3d_create_stream_output_target()
1318 struct pipe_resource *prsc = iview->base.resource; in v3d_create_image_view_texture_shader_state() local
/external/mesa3d/src/gallium/drivers/freedreno/
Dfreedreno_resource.c72 struct pipe_resource *prsc = &rsc->base; in rebind_resource_in_ctx() local
181 struct pipe_resource *prsc = &rsc->base; in realloc_bo() local
243 struct pipe_resource *prsc = &rsc->base; in fd_try_shadow_resource() local
559 fd_flush_resource(struct pipe_context *pctx, struct pipe_resource *prsc) in fd_flush_resource()
592 struct pipe_resource *prsc, in fd_resource_transfer_map()
801 struct pipe_resource *prsc) in fd_resource_destroy()
833 struct pipe_resource *prsc, in fd_resource_get_handle()
855 fd_resource_resize(struct pipe_resource *prsc, uint32_t sz) in fd_resource_resize()
868 fd_resource_layout_init(struct pipe_resource *prsc) in fd_resource_layout_init()
898 struct pipe_resource *prsc; in fd_resource_allocate_and_resolve() local
[all …]
Dfreedreno_resource.h169 fd_resource_set_usage(struct pipe_resource *prsc, enum fd_dirty_3d_state usage) in fd_resource_set_usage()
246 fd_resource_level_linear(const struct pipe_resource *prsc, int level) in fd_resource_level_linear()
255 fd_resource_tile_mode(struct pipe_resource *prsc, int level) in fd_resource_tile_mode()
270 fd_resource_nr_samples(struct pipe_resource *prsc) in fd_resource_nr_samples()
Dfreedreno_context.c323 struct pipe_resource *prsc = pipe_buffer_create(pctx->screen, in create_solid_vertexbuf() local
333 struct pipe_resource *prsc = pipe_buffer_create(pctx->screen, in create_blit_texcoord_vertexbuf() local
Dfreedreno_draw.c46 resource_read(struct fd_batch *batch, struct pipe_resource *prsc) in resource_read()
54 resource_written(struct fd_batch *batch, struct pipe_resource *prsc) in resource_written()
Dfreedreno_query_acc.h79 struct pipe_resource *prsc; member
/external/mesa3d/src/gallium/drivers/vc4/
Dvc4_resource.c44 struct pipe_resource *prsc = &rsc->base; in vc4_resource_bo_alloc() local
100 struct pipe_resource *prsc, in vc4_resource_transfer_map()
236 struct pipe_resource *prsc, in vc4_texture_subdata()
274 struct pipe_resource *prsc) in vc4_resource_destroy()
289 struct pipe_resource *prsc, in vc4_resource_get_handle()
341 struct pipe_resource *prsc = &rsc->base; in vc4_setup_slices() local
444 struct pipe_resource *prsc = &rsc->base; in vc4_resource_setup() local
462 get_resource_texture_format(struct pipe_resource *prsc) in get_resource_texture_format()
489 struct pipe_resource *prsc = &rsc->base; in vc4_resource_create_with_modifiers() local
606 struct pipe_resource *prsc = &rsc->base; in vc4_resource_from_handle() local
[all …]
Dvc4_job.c100 struct pipe_resource *prsc) in vc4_flush_jobs_writing_resource()
112 struct pipe_resource *prsc) in vc4_flush_jobs_reading_resource()
/external/mesa3d/src/gallium/drivers/etnaviv/
Detnaviv_resource.c165 struct pipe_resource *prsc = &rsc->base; in setup_miptree() local
448 etna_resource_changed(struct pipe_screen *pscreen, struct pipe_resource *prsc) in etna_resource_changed()
454 etna_resource_destroy(struct pipe_screen *pscreen, struct pipe_resource *prsc) in etna_resource_destroy()
493 struct pipe_resource *prsc; in etna_resource_from_handle() local
576 struct pipe_resource *prsc, in etna_resource_get_handle()
605 etna_resource_used(struct etna_context *ctx, struct pipe_resource *prsc, in etna_resource_used()
Detnaviv_transfer.c63 struct pipe_resource *prsc = ptrans->resource; in etna_patch_data() local
89 struct pipe_resource *prsc = ptrans->resource; in etna_unpatch_data() local
191 etna_transfer_map(struct pipe_context *pctx, struct pipe_resource *prsc, in etna_transfer_map()
Detnaviv_surface.c43 etna_render_handle_incompatible(struct pipe_context *pctx, struct pipe_resource *prsc) in etna_render_handle_incompatible()
77 etna_create_surface(struct pipe_context *pctx, struct pipe_resource *prsc, in etna_create_surface()
Detnaviv_surface.h45 struct pipe_resource *prsc; member
Detnaviv_resource.h159 resource_read(struct etna_context *ctx, struct pipe_resource *prsc) in resource_read()
165 resource_written(struct etna_context *ctx, struct pipe_resource *prsc) in resource_written()
Detnaviv_query_acc.h50 struct pipe_resource *prsc; member
/external/mesa3d/src/gallium/auxiliary/util/
Du_transfer_helper.c42 static inline bool handle_transfer(struct pipe_resource *prsc) in handle_transfer()
90 struct pipe_resource *prsc; in u_transfer_helper_resource_create() local
136 struct pipe_resource *prsc) in u_transfer_helper_resource_destroy()
161 struct pipe_resource *prsc, in transfer_map_msaa()
230 struct pipe_resource *prsc, in u_transfer_helper_transfer_map()
558 struct pipe_resource *prsc, in u_transfer_helper_deinterleave_transfer_map()
/external/mesa3d/src/gallium/drivers/freedreno/a6xx/
Dfd6_resource.c148 struct pipe_resource *prsc = &rsc->base; in fd6_setup_slices() local
168 struct pipe_resource *prsc = &rsc->base; in fill_ubwc_buffer_sizes() local
Dfd6_image.c39 struct pipe_resource *prsc; member
60 struct pipe_resource *prsc = pimg->resource; in translate_image() local
137 struct pipe_resource *prsc = pimg->buffer; in translate_buf() local
/external/mesa3d/src/gallium/drivers/freedreno/a5xx/
Dfd5_resource.c60 struct pipe_resource *prsc = &rsc->base; in fd5_setup_slices() local
/external/mesa3d/src/gallium/drivers/freedreno/a2xx/
Dfd2_emit.h38 struct pipe_resource *prsc; member
Dfd2_resource.c32 struct pipe_resource *prsc = &rsc->base; in fd2_setup_slices() local
Dfd2_context.c63 struct pipe_resource *prsc = pipe_buffer_create(pctx->screen, in create_solid_vertexbuf() local
/external/mesa3d/src/gallium/drivers/freedreno/a4xx/
Dfd4_resource.c33 struct pipe_resource *prsc = &rsc->base; in fd4_setup_slices() local
/external/mesa3d/src/gallium/drivers/freedreno/a3xx/
Dfd3_resource.c31 struct pipe_resource *prsc = &rsc->base; in setup_slices() local

123